Yeah your body produces a kind of lubricant in your joints when you exercise so going on regular walks often does the trick compared to workouts which will primarily focus on muscle growth and can in fact sometimes make your joints worse if you dont strengthen them first. It puts stress on them they may not be able to handle yet. There are exercises you can do which will focus on your joints specifically, too.
